What is Masquerade Ball in Dark Romance?

A masquerade ball functions as a high-stakes setting for dark romance by removing the social safeguards of identity. When faces are hidden, the usual rules of propriety dissolve. The setting relies on the tension between who people are in the light of day and who they become when no one can identify them. It is a space of performative seduction and calculated risk. In works like Stanley Kubrick’s *Eyes Wide Shut* or the classic gothic tension found in Gaston Leroux’s *The Phantom of the Opera*, the masquerade serves as a catalyst for hidden desires to surface. The environment forces a collision between individuals who might otherwise never interact, creating an atmosphere where secrets are currency and vulnerability is a trap. In a dark romance context, this setting is not just a party; it is a hunting ground. The anonymity provides a shield for the morally gray protagonist or love interest to pursue their obsessions without the interference of their public reputation. By removing the ability to judge a person based on their history or status, the masquerade ensures that the connection formed is raw, immediate, and often volatile. It forces the participants to rely on intuition, touch, and the dangerous magnetism of a stranger whose true intent remains obscured until the final moment of the night.

What makes Masquerade Ball work: the worldbuilding

The effectiveness of the masquerade as a storytelling device lies in the sensory overload and the psychological safety of the mask. Characters are stripped of their public personas, creating a vacuum that must be filled by raw instinct. The worldbuilding here focuses on the contrast between the opulence of the ballroom and the cold, isolated nature of the encounters occurring in the periphery. Consider the way the atmosphere in *Labyrinth* uses the ball as a deceptive trap, or how the gothic tradition utilizes the setting to isolate characters from the help of the outside world. To make this setting work, the environment must feel claustrophobic despite the grand architecture. You use mirrors to reflect masked figures, heavy velvet curtains to create private nooks, and the constant, low-frequency hum of a string quartet that masks the sound of whispered threats. Character archetypes thrive in this setting. You have the 'Obsessive Pursuer'—the figure in the black mask who has known you for years but is only now acting on their impulses because they believe they are hidden. You have the 'Dangerous Stranger'—someone from a rival house or a different social stratum who uses the mask to bridge a gap that would be forbidden in the light. The conflict arises from the constant threat of discovery. The mask is not just an accessory; it is a psychological barrier. The moment that barrier is removed, the power dynamic shifts irrevocably. The story succeeds when it balances the elegance of the setting with the underlying threat of violence or ruin. It is the ultimate playground for dark romance because it promises that for one night, the rules of reality do not apply, and the consequences of your choices will only begin when the clock strikes midnight.

What makes a masquerade ball setting different from a standard romance?

Standard romance often relies on the established social standing and history of the characters. A masquerade ball removes these anchors by providing anonymity. This allows characters to act out suppressed desires or explore power dynamics that would be impossible in their public lives, adding a layer of risk and obsession that is central to the dark romance genre.
